Lazio are reportedly studying the transfer market to line up possible replacements for Sergej Milinkovic-Savic.

The Aquile sporting director Igli Tare confirmed that the club considers the situation and desire of the Serbian and could have to evaluate a possible sale.

Il Corriere dello Sport therefore claims the Biancocelesti have started browsing the transfer market in search of a possible replacement, should one of the European giants manage to lure Milinkovic away from the Olimpico.

The newspaper claims Lazio are prepared to enter the chase for three Serie A targets, mentioning Benfica’s Florentin Luis, Joao Palhinha from Sporting Braga and Wolverhampton Wanderers midfielder Leander Dendoncker.

The Serbian international Milikovic-Savic could still stay at Lazio, who are aiming for the Scudetto this term and are gunning for a place in the Champions League next season, but Tare is allegedly preparing a list of players in case he should leave.
